The FH541V Voltage Regulator boasts a robust capacity of 15–20 AMP, which is crucial for ensuring that the electrical system of your Kawasaki engine operates smoothly. This regulator is designed to replace several part numbers, including 21066-7003, 21066-7001, 21066-7006, and 21066-7011. Understanding the Importance of a Voltage Regulator
When I first began my journey with the Kawasaki FX801V, I quickly realized how crucial the voltage regulator is for my engine’s performance. This component ensures that the electrical system operates smoothly by maintaining a consistent voltage level. Without a properly functioning voltage regulator, I noticed that my engine experienced irregular power supply, which could lead to various operational issues.
